Trump Refuses to Explain ‘Obamagate’: ‘You Know What the Crime Is!’

Justin Baragona
Published May. 11, 2020 5:42PM ET 
Confronted on his Mother’s Day tweets in which he accused former President Barack Obama of committing the “biggest political crime in American history,” President Donald Trump refused to explain what the actual crime was. “Obamagate,” Trump exclaimed Monday afternoon when asked by Washington Post reporter Philip Rucker to provide an explanation. “It’s been going on for a long time!”

After Trump offered no specifics, Rucker again asked him what is the exact crime he is accusing his predecessor of. “You know what the crime is. The crime is very obvious to everybody, all you have to do is read the newspapers, except yours.”

REALITY BITES: Trump Sabotages His Own Coronavirus ‘Mission Accomplished’ Moment
The president had a banner proclaiming “AMERICA leads the world in testing” and a message of strength to deliver. But it all crumbled when he stormed out of his briefing.
 

Kevin Lamarque/Reuters
It had all the trappings of a “Mission Accomplished” moment: the banner, the presidential pomp, and a message that wasn’t true. 

But what President Donald Trump wanted Monday to be a show of strength over his administration’s coronavirus testing push, complete with a banner touting “AMERICA leads the world in testing,” ended under tough questioning by reporters, causing the president to storm off abruptly.
